Composition and thermophysical properties of metallurgical plasmas - LTE calculations
<div> <p>This dataset contains two subsets:</p> <p>First - elemental compositions of the equilibrium gas phase over a variety of metallurgical processes conducted in direct-current plasma arc furnaces at a range of slag temperatures between the typical process temperature and the vaporisation temperature (defined as the lowest temperature at which only a gas phase exists). These were obtained from process simulations using thermochemical calculation software.</p> <p>Second - plasma composition and thermophysical properties at a range of plasma temperatures between 2000 K and 30000K under local thermodynamic equilibrium conditions, as calculated using minplascalc software (https://github.com/quinnreynolds/minplascalc, commit 967faf3). All calculations are at atmospheric pressure, and use the elemental gas phase compositions for each slag temperature to define the mass conservation constraints.</p> </div> <h2></h2>
